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8405863 835119 76
706633 84 96
706633 84 96
84701 19487 96866292
All about undefined
Interested in learning more?
706633 84 96
84701 19487 96866292
See more
72925 1922 53
35732 9978157272 252024693
See more
904 3240457203 2585451366
12136691 0036 674517 18
See more